Output 3ff03dfb4a0ac86b39a074186d1127ac0b8331e66d86c52d59cf24868868bbfa:1

value
21132
script pubkey
OP_0 OP_PUSHBYTES_20 e6f01d1d3897fd5c7c72d6817ba9d6032259a4e6
address
bc1qumcp68fcjl74clrj66qhh2wkqv39nf8x9yctz9
transaction
3ff03dfb4a0ac86b39a074186d1127ac0b8331e66d86c52d59cf24868868bbfa
confirmations
308199
spent
true